Description
This sub-bottom profiler is EdgeTech's long running success story in providing Full Spectrum (“chirp”) imaging. Under any conditions when compared to other sub-bottom profilers, the SB-512i provides better images more deployment options, and interface flexibility.

The SB-512i has a frequency range from 500 Hz to 12 kHz. This system uses special design transmitters with low Q widesband characteristics best suited for “chirp” transmissions. If conventional off-the-shelf transducers are used then there is a need to compensate in software for the narrow band characteristics of the transmitters. The result is visible in the images created. At least two hydrophones are installed in the tow vehicle to reduce acoustic scattering from the sides. This results in a narrower across track beam pattern. Preserved in the output of the Full Spectrum chirp processing in the signal phase.

This phase information is also recorded to the mass storage device. This phase information is required for sub-surface sediment classification. Phase is used to determine if the impedance is increasing or decreasing. EdgeTech separates the Full Spectrum signal processing and the signal amplifier out into separate housings. This lets a user interface to his own or a 3 rd party topside display processor or command, control, display, printing and d ata storage.

Sonographics offers all three towfish options for the 3200-XS: SB-512i, SB-216S, and SB-424 tow vehicles that chirp over different frequency ranges. The same topside Full Spectrum signal processor, linear amplifier and tow cable are compatible with each of the vehicles. Use different tow vehicles for desired penetration and resolution. The FM pulse is user selected based on the sub-bottom conditions at the survey site and the type of sub-bottom features that need to be imaged.
